Cardiology focuses on the diagnosis and management of disorders related to the heart and blood vessels, and if you are diagnosed with heart disease or cardiovascular issues, you will be directed to see a cardiologist. A cardiologist has expertise in identifying and treating conditions affecting the cardiovascular system. Additionally, the cardiologist will conduct various tests and may carry out procedures like heart catheterizations, angioplasty, or the insertion of a pacemaker.
Indian hospitals are equipped with the latest advancements that are used in cardiology treatment, which include:
Technique | Description |
3D Printing | It helps in creating a physical model of the patient’s heart, which helps doctors to better understand your anatomy and surgery planning. |
Robotic Assisted Surgery | It allows for minimally invasive procedures, which helps in improving precision, reducing the risk of complications, and providing faster recovery. |
Advanced Imaging Equipment | Advanced imaging equipment, such as cardiac MRI and CT that allows for more accurate and detailed images of your heart, and it is also beneficial in monitoring treatment progress. |
Implantable Devices | Devices such as pacemakers and defibrillators have allowed the treatment of various heart conditions such as arrhythmias and heart failure. |
Extracorporeal Membrane Oxygenation (ECMO) | It's a technology that supports the heart and lungs in severe failure. This procedure involves using a machine that pumps and oxygenates a patient's blood outside the body. |
Electrophysiology (EP) Lab | It's a lab specialized facility that allows doctors to diagnose and treat abnormal heart rhythms. |

Yes, a heart attack is a circulation problem in which blood flow to the heart is blocked, while cardiac arrest is an electrical problem in which the heart suddenly stops beating effectively.
